Transaction 73cec903231aaee8553bbb5c1170374db46bab80fb2aa0bf70a8bce6141779d0

1 Input
2 Outputs
  • 73cec903231aaee8553bbb5c1170374db46bab80fb2aa0bf70a8bce6141779d0:0
  • value  1356819897
    address  3KxGsPVCM2Wc1RDcr3ajshZjyp9FmcEdKE
  • 73cec903231aaee8553bbb5c1170374db46bab80fb2aa0bf70a8bce6141779d0:1
  • value  1263775
    address  3HkcedGUNGhNa4CBhMhPM3XrWaaRSDGgZw